def _convert_rich_link(rich_link: dict[str, Any]) -> str:
"""Convert a richLink element (URL chip) to markdown."""
props = rich_link.get("richLinkProperties", {})
title = props.get("title", "")
uri = props.get("uri", "")
if title and uri:
return f"[{title}]({uri})"
return title or uri


def _convert_person(person: dict[str, Any]) -> str:
"""Convert a person element (person chip) to markdown."""
props = person.get("personProperties", {})
name = props.get("name", "")
email = props.get("email", "")
if name and email:
return f"{name} ({email})"
return name or email
